UNIVERSITY OF
RHODE ISLAND
FACULTY SENATE
REPORT OF THE
EXECUTIVE COMMITTEE
November 2005
When the Joint Strategic
Planning Committee was established in the spring of 2003, its
responsibilities included those previously assigned to the Advisory
Committee on Resource Allocation (ACRA). Since that time, the
Executive Committee of the Faculty Senate has decided each fall not to
appoint the members of ACRA because the Joint Strategic Planning
Committee (JSPC) had assumed ACRA’s function as set forth in University
Manual Sections 5.70.10 to 5.70.12 inclusive.
Agreeing that the JSPC has
replaced the Advisory Committee on Resource (ACRA), the Executive
Committee recommends that the Faculty Senate approve the committee’s
elimination.
Recommendation
The Executive Committee
recommends that the Advisory Committee on Resource Allocation (ACRA) be
eliminated and that the following sections of the UNIVERSITY MANUAL be
deleted:
5.72.10 The Advisory Committee on
Resource Allocation (ACRA) shall serve as an advisory committee
on resource allocation to the Vice President for Administration. It may
also serve as an additional vehicle for communication within the
University community.
5.72.11 The committee shall
review and analyze the University's income and expenditure patterns
with particular attention to the basic assumptions and priorities that
underlie these patterns. In conducting these analyses, the committee
shall review budget data from comparable institutions to provide
context and external benchmarks. The committee will be consulted and
may offer advice on budget priorities prior to the finalization of the
prospective unrestricted budget request, including new initiatives
submitted by the University to the Board of Governors and may be
consulted and may offer advice prior to the implementation in the event
of major state recissionary requirements.
5.72.12 The committee shall
consist of four faculty members appointed by the Faculty Senate and
four members appointed by the President. The Vice President for
Administration shall serve as a non-voting ex officio member. The
Chairperson shall be appointed jointly by the President and the
Chairperson of the Faculty Senate.
5.72.13 The committee may
participate in the annual report on the budget to the Faculty Senate
and may report as needed to the Faculty Senate on major modifications
to the budget during the academic year. The Faculty Senate's
representatives shall report once each year to the Faculty Senate and
whenever there is a major change.
